[
https://issues.apache.org/jira/browse/AMQ-7452?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17132966#comment-17132966
]
wangxiaoqing commented on AMQ-7452:
-----------------------------------
"MQTTInactivityMonitor Async Task:
java.util.concurrent.ThreadPoolExecutor$Worker@3992a088[State = -1, empty
queue]" #320435 daemon prio=5 os_prio=0 tid=0x00007f1018952800 nid=0xf590
waiting for monitor entry [0x00007f0f1e26e000]
java.lang.Thread.State: BLOCKED (on object monitor)
at
org.apache.activemq.broker.TransportConnection.stopAsync(TransportConnection.java:1136)
- waiting to lock <0x0000000731d552e0> (a
org.apache.activemq.broker.jmx.ManagedTransportConnection)
at
org.apache.activemq.broker.jmx.ManagedTransportConnection.stopAsync(ManagedTransportConnection.java:66)
at
org.apache.activemq.broker.TransportConnection.stopAsync(TransportConnection.java:1131)
at
org.apache.activemq.broker.TransportConnection.serviceTransportException(TransportConnection.java:239)
at
org.apache.activemq.broker.TransportConnection$1.onException(TransportConnection.java:210)
at
org.apache.activemq.transport.TransportFilter.onException(TransportFilter.java:114)
at
org.apache.activemq.transport.mqtt.MQTTInactivityMonitor.onException(MQTTInactivityMonitor.java:196)
at
org.apache.activemq.transport.mqtt.MQTTInactivityMonitor$1$1.run(MQTTInactivityMonitor.java:81)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
"MQTTInactivityMonitor Async Task:
java.util.concurrent.ThreadPoolExecutor$Worker@2bf53728[State = -1, empty
queue]" #320402 daemon prio=5 os_prio=0 tid=0x00007f1018951800 nid=0xf56f
waiting for monitor entry [0x00007f0f158e5000]
java.lang.Thread.State: BLOCKED (on object monitor)
at
org.apache.activemq.broker.TransportConnection.stopAsync(TransportConnection.java:1136)
- waiting to lock <0x0000000731d12260> (a
org.apache.activemq.broker.jmx.ManagedTransportConnection)
at
org.apache.activemq.broker.jmx.ManagedTransportConnection.stopAsync(ManagedTransportConnection.java:66)
at
org.apache.activemq.broker.TransportConnection.stopAsync(TransportConnection.java:1131)
at
org.apache.activemq.broker.TransportConnection.serviceTransportException(TransportConnection.java:239)
at
org.apache.activemq.broker.TransportConnection$1.onException(TransportConnection.java:210)
at
org.apache.activemq.transport.TransportFilter.onException(TransportFilter.java:114)
at
org.apache.activemq.transport.mqtt.MQTTInactivityMonitor.onException(MQTTInactivityMonitor.java:196)
at
org.apache.activemq.transport.mqtt.MQTTInactivityMonitor$1$1.run(MQTTInactivityMonitor.java:81)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
> java.lang.IllegalStateException: Timer already cancelled.
> ---------------------------------------------------------
>
> Key: AMQ-7452
> URL: https://issues.apache.org/jira/browse/AMQ-7452
> Project: ActiveMQ
> Issue Type: Bug
> Components: Broker
> Affects Versions: 5.15.3
> Reporter: wangxiaoqing
> Priority: Blocker
> Attachments: activemq.xml, docker-mq.yaml
>
>
> 2020-03-24 12:54:47,990 | ERROR | Could not accept connection from
> tcp://10.0.1.5:41212 : {} | org.apache.activemq.broker.TransportConnector |
> ActiveMQ BrokerService[localhost] Task-174422020-03-24 12:54:47,990 | ERROR |
> Could not accept connection from tcp://10.0.1.5:41212 : {} |
> org.apache.activemq.broker.TransportConnector | ActiveMQ
> BrokerService[localhost] Task-17442java.lang.IllegalStateException: Timer
> already cancelled. at java.util.Timer.sched(Timer.java:397)[:1.8.0_191] at
> java.util.Timer.schedule(Timer.java:193)[:1.8.0_191] at
> org.apache.activemq.transport.AbstractInactivityMonitor.startConnectCheckTask(AbstractInactivityMonitor.java:425)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.transport.AbstractInactivityMonitor.startConnectCheckTask(AbstractInactivityMonitor.java:400)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.transport.InactivityMonitor.start(InactivityMonitor.java:50)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.transport.TransportFilter.start(TransportFilter.java:64)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.transport.WireFormatNegotiator.start(WireFormatNegotiator.java:72)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.transport.TransportFilter.start(TransportFilter.java:64)[activemq-client-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.broker.TransportConnection.start(TransportConnection.java:1066)[activemq-broker-5.15.3.jar:5.15.3]
> at
> org.apache.activemq.broker.TransportConnector$1$1.run(TransportConnector.java:218)[activemq-broker-5.15.3.jar:5.15.3]
> at
> java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)[:1.8.0_191]
> at
> java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)[:1.8.0_191]
> at java.lang.Thread.run(Thread.java:748)[:1.8.0_191]
--
This message was sent by Atlassian Jira
(v8.3.4#803005)